コード例 #1
0
ファイル: TipoUnidad.cs プロジェクト: chaqui/SGREB
        /// <summary>
        /// crear el tipo de unidad en la base de datos
        /// </summary>
        /// <param name="tvTipoUnidad"></param>
        public void Crear(TV_TipoUnidad tvTipoUnidad)
        {
            var bitacora = new bitacoraBomberoaContext();

            bitacora.TV_TipoUnidad.Add(tvTipoUnidad);
            bitacora.SaveChanges();
        }
コード例 #2
0
ファイル: TipoUnidadForm.xaml.cs プロジェクト: chaqui/SGREB
        private void btIngresarTipo_Click(object sender, RoutedEventArgs e)
        {
            var unidad = txTipoUnidad.Text;

            if (unidad == "")
            {
                MessageBox.Show("No ingreso ningun dato", "error");
                return;
            }
            else
            {
                TipoUnidad unidadTipo   = new TipoUnidad();
                var        tvTipoUnidad = new TV_TipoUnidad();
                tvTipoUnidad.nombreTipo = unidad;
                if (forma == 1)
                {
                    unidadTipo.Crear(tvTipoUnidad);
                }
                else
                {
                    tvTipoUnidad.idTipoUnidad = idTipoUnidad;
                    unidadTipo.modificar(tvTipoUnidad);
                }

                this.Close();
            }
        }
コード例 #3
0
ファイル: TipoUnidad.cs プロジェクト: chaqui/SGREB
 internal void modificar(TV_TipoUnidad tvTipoUnidad)
 {
     using (var bitacora = new bitacoraBomberoaContext())
     {
         var tvTipoUnidadModificar = bitacora.TV_TipoUnidad.Find(tvTipoUnidad.idTipoUnidad);
         tvTipoUnidadModificar.nombreTipo = tvTipoUnidad.nombreTipo;
         bitacora.SaveChanges();
     }
 }